Reading about receptor desensitisation and trying to work out which of the effects adapt over time and which do not, because people clearly experience both.

The narrow version of the question is which effects tachyphylax and which persist, because the answer explains why tolerability improves while the appetite effect keeps working.

Agreeing with TrialTracker_MD, and the qualification matters more than the agreement. The mechanism is more central than most summaries suggest. Receptor agonism in the arcuate nucleus activates POMC neurons and inhibits AgRP/NPY signalling, and the downstream MC4R pathway is the same one disrupted in monogenic obesity — convergent genetic evidence that the target is the right one. Peripherally there is glucose-dependent insulin secretion, glucagon suppression and delayed gastric emptying, but the gastric component largely adapts over months while the central effect persists, which is why the durable effect is appetite rather than fullness.

Adding the clinical framing, because it changes how the question reads.

Semaglutide structural biology relevant to the pharmacology: semaglutide is a 31-amino acid peptide with 94% homology to native GLP-1(7-36). Three key modifications enable its pharmacokinetic profile:

  1. Aib8 substitution: DPP-4 resistance (prevents enzymatic degradation)
  2. Arg34 substitution: improved chemical stability
  3. C18 fatty diacid at Lys26: albumin binding → long half-life

These three modifications transform a peptide with a 2-minute half-life (native GLP-1) into one with a 168-hour half-life (semaglutide). A masterclass in peptide engineering.
